KRA misses target by Sh267bn as corporate earnings tumble

The Kenya Revenue Authority (KRA) missed its target for the full year ended June by Sh267 billion, hurt by reduced corporate profits and job cuts in a period when businesses were devastated by the depreciation of the shilling and high energy prices. Fitch Cyprus upgrade a , ‘vote of confidence’

Fitch has raised the sovereign credit rating for Cyprus by a notch, with the country’s president saying this is a “vote of confidence” and a reward for maintaining a resilient economy. Cypriot banks first quarter profits hit , €226 million

Increased interest income from successive interest rate hikes by the European Central Bank significantly boosted Cypriot banks’ profits in the first quarter of 2024, with the Bank of Cyprus reporting a 31% increase in net interest income and Hellenic Bank seeing a 40% rise.

This is what we did and this is what we got from the EU Recovery Fund

Cyprus has managed to promote important reforms and launch public investments through the Recovery Plan, with more than 40 sponsorship projects announced. The amount available through the sponsorship projects is €460 million. The country has received €262 million from the European fund, with additional tranches expected to be disbursed later this year.

Cyprus sees slight increase in non-performing loans

– The balance of non-performing loans (NPLs) in Cyprus rose to €1.9 billion in January 2024.
– The total amount of loans in January 2024 stood at €24.02 billion.
– The slight rise in NPLs is attributed to an increase in non-performing business loans.

Astrobank bucks trend with new branch , — will seek approval for dividend

Astrobank is opening a new branch in the Dali area in Nicosia, which is considered an underserved location with no existing banking facilities. The bank will seek regulatory approval from the Central Bank of Cyprus to distribute dividends and aims to reduce non-performing loans to single digits by July. Astrobank has a capital adequacy ratio of 23.7% and has already met the Minimum Requirements for Own Funds and Eligible Liabilities. The bank is optimistic about the future and is open to acquisitions and evaluating new opportunities in the banking sector.

Eurobank Group reports robust first quarter results

Eurobank Holdings released its financial results for the first quarter of 2024, showing significant growth and robust performance. Adjusted net profits in Cyprus and Bulgaria improved substantially, with Cyprus reaching €92 million.

The worst economic crisis in Turkish Cypriot history

Fact: The annual inflation rate in the northern part of Cyprus hit 94.5 per cent in March, with monthly food inflation reaching 3.4 per cent.

Kedipes offers repayment plan for NPLs

Kedipes has announced a new repayment plan for non-performing loans that would be secured by a primary residence with a market value of up to €350,000. Eligible borrowers can fully repay their loan obligations by paying an amount calculated with a significant percentage discount on the market value of the mortgaged residence.
